Canadian Imperial Bank of Commerce (TSE:CM – Get Free Report) (NYSE:CM) released its quarterly earnings data on Thursday. The company reported C$2.73 EPS for the quarter, FiscalAI reports. The company had revenue of C$8.37 billion for the quarter. Canadian Imperial Bank of Commerce had a return on equity of 15.24% and a net margin of 18.44%.

Canadian Imperial Bank of Commerce Company Profile
CIBC is a leading North American financial institution with 15 million personal banking, business, public sector and institutional clients. Across Personal and Business Banking, Commercial Banking and Wealth Management, and Capital Markets, CIBC offers a full range of advice, solutions and services through its leading digital banking network, and locations across Canada, in the United States and around the world.
